Elizabeth Anne Dundas Bedell 1822–1889 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 12 August 1822

Birth Location: New York

Death Date: 5 December 1889

Death Location: Connecticut

Father: Gregory Bedell

Mother: Penelope Thurston

Spouse(s): Frederick Benjamin

Children(s): Arthur Benjamin

The story of Elizabeth Anne Dundas Bedell began in 1822 in New York. Elizabeth Anne Dundas Bedell married Frederick Augustus Benjamin, and had children including Arthur Bedell Benjamin. Elizabeth Anne Dundas Bedell passed away in 1889 in Connecticut.
